Recent Form Insights: Hideki Matsuyama
- Matsuyama has made the weekend and finished in the top 20 on the leaderboard twice in his past four tournaments.
- Out of the past four tournaments he entered, he made the cut three times.
- In his past four events, Matsuyama has finished within five shots of the leader once. He carded a score better than average twice.
- He has carded an average score of -4 in his past four events.
- Over his last 13 rounds, Matsuyama has finished below par eight times, while also posting one par-or-better round and six rounds with a better-than-average score.
- He has carded one of the top five scores in three of his last 13 rounds.

Last Time Out
- Matsuyama was in the 83rd percentile on par 3s at the Farmers Insurance Open, averaging 2.88 strokes on the 16 par-3 holes.
- His 4.15-stroke average on the 40 par-4 holes at the Farmers Insurance Open placed him poorly, in the 19th percentile of the field.
- Matsuyama shot better than 97% of the field at the Farmers Insurance Open on the tournament’s 16 par-5 holes, averaging 4.25 strokes per hole compared to the field average of 4.6.
- Matsuyama carded a birdie or better on two of the 16 par-3 holes at the Farmers Insurance Open, outperforming the field average of 1.6.
- On the 16 par-3 holes at the Farmers Insurance Open, Matsuyama carded one bogey or worse (less than the field average of 1.9).
- Matsuyama’s four birdies or better on par-4 holes at the Farmers Insurance Open were less than the field average (4.6).
